Regular Season Round 8: MBK Ruzomb. - Slovan 109-36
Date: November 24, 2018
Extraliga top team - MBK Ruzomberok (9-0) had no problems winning another game on Saturday. This time they crushed seventh ranked Slovan (1-7) 109-36. MBK Ruzomberok held Slovan to an opponent 21.1 percent shooting from the field compared to 50.6 percent accuracy of the winners. MBK Ruzomberok forced 21 Slovan turnovers and outrebounded them 58-19 including a 23-3 advantage in offensive rebounds. They looked well-organized offensively handing out 22 assists comparing to just 3 passes made by Slovan's players. The winners were led by American guard Chucky Jeffery (178-91, college: Colorado) who had that evening a double-double by scoring 17 points, 13 rebounds, 5 assists and 6 steals and Lithuanian power forward Egle Siksniute (198-91) supported her with 21 points and 9 rebounds. Five MBK Ruzomberok players scored in double figures. MBK Ruzomberok's coach Juraj Suja felt very confident using 11 players which allowed the starters a little rest for the next games. Even 5 points and 5 rebounds by center Renata Talajkova (190-81) did not help to save the game for Slovan. Lucia Luttmerdingova (174-99) added 6 points for the guests. MBK Ruzomberok have an impressive nine-game winning streak. They maintain first position with 9-0 record. Slovan at the other side keeps the seventh place with seven games lost. MBK Ruzomberok will meet at home bottom-ranked Banska Bystrica (#8) in the next round and are hoping to win another game. Slovan will play against Samorin and it may be a tough game between close rivals.
